What are keratin supplements?
Keratin is a tough structural protein that forms the outer layer of every hair strand, giving it strength and protection. Keratin supplements aim to support your body's own keratin and the building blocks it needs. They come as capsules, powders and gummies, often blended with biotin, amino acids, vitamins and minerals that play a part in normal hair and skin.
What can keratin supplements realistically do?
Used consistently as part of a good routine, people often look to them for:
| What people hope for | The honest picture |
|---|---|
| Stronger, less brittle hair | Supporting the hair's protein and nutrients can help reduce breakage |
| More shine and less frizz | Healthier-looking strands often appear smoother and glossier |
| Faster growth | Supplements support hair as it grows, they do not speed up the rate |
| A cure for hair loss | Not a fair expectation, ongoing loss needs a GP, not a supplement |
How do you choose a good keratin supplement?
Check the source
Keratin can be animal-derived (from feathers or wool) or you may prefer a vegan formula that supplies the nutrients your body uses to build its own keratin. If you avoid animal products, look for a clearly labelled vegan option.
Look at the supporting ingredients
- Biotin and zinc: contribute to the maintenance of normal hair.
- Amino acids: the building blocks your body uses to make keratin.
- Vitamins and minerals: such as vitamin C, which supports normal collagen formation.
Pick a form you will actually take
Consistency matters more than format. A gummy is easy to remember, a capsule is quick, a powder mixes into a drink. Choose what fits your day.

How to get the best from keratin supplements
- Take them daily and stick with it, results build over weeks not days.
- Eat a varied diet with protein, iron, zinc and the B vitamins.
- Stay hydrated and go easy on heat styling to protect the hair you have.
- If you have an allergy or take medication, check with a pharmacist before starting.
Frequently asked questions
Can keratin supplements help with hair loss?
They support stronger, healthier-looking hair but are not a treatment for hair loss. If your hair is genuinely thinning or shedding, see your GP.
How long until I see results?
Most people give it 6 to 12 weeks of consistent daily use before judging the difference.
Are keratin supplements safe?
They are generally well tolerated. If you have allergies (especially to animal products) or take medication, check with a pharmacist first.
Are vegan keratin supplements as good?
Yes. Vegan formulas supply the nutrients your body uses to build its own keratin, which suits most people well.
